Africa’s Mobile Money Ecosystem Embraces Blockchain to Drive X-Border Real-Time Payments

November 27, 2022
In 2020, scientists at the University of Zambia (UNZA) proposed a clearing and settlement architecture that would allow interoperability between mobile money payment networks based on a distributed ledger system. The researchers argued that a payment infrastructure based on a centralized database is ill-suited to the way people use mobile money and creates significant barriers […]

Western Union Turns to MFS to Expand Global Money Transfers

March 05, 2023
Western Union has teamed with MFS Africa to allow mobile money transfers across the continent. The partnership will allow Western Union users in 200 countries around the world to send funds to the more than 400 million mobile wallets in the MFS network, the companies said in a statement shared with African FinTech news source […]
